The Foundations of the Ma Dynasty

Ma Yuankun was born in 1992, a pivotal era in the modern economic history of China. At the time of his birth, his father, Jack Ma, was not yet the global icon of e-commerce but a struggling entrepreneur and former English teacher. His mother, Zhang Ying (Cathy Zhang), played an equally critical role in the family’s trajectory, having been one of the original 18 founders of Alibaba. Growing up during the hyper-growth phase of the Chinese internet sector, Yuankun witnessed firsthand the transition of his family from modest academic roots to the pinnacle of global wealth.

Unlike many children of billionaires who are thrust into the limelight from a young age, Yuankun’s upbringing was characterized by a strict focus on academic discipline and a shielding from the media. Jack Ma has often spoken about the challenges of balancing his meteoric rise with fatherhood. In several interviews, Ma noted that during Alibaba’s early years, he was often absent, a reality that shaped his later philosophy on parenting and the importance of self-reliance for his children.

Educational Excellence: The UC Berkeley Years

The academic journey of Ma Yuankun is perhaps the most documented aspect of his private life. Following his primary and secondary education in China, he moved to the United States to attend the University of California, Berkeley. This choice of institution was strategic; UC Berkeley is not only a world-class academic powerhouse but is also situated in the heart of the San Francisco Bay Area, the epicenter of global technological innovation.

At Berkeley, Yuankun was known to be a diligent student who avoided the ostentatious displays of wealth often associated with the children of the Chinese elite. He focused his studies on areas that aligned with the evolving digital landscape, though the specific details of his major have been kept relatively confidential to protect his privacy. His time in California allowed him to immerse himself in a culture of meritocracy, where he was judged on his intellectual contributions rather than his family name.

Observers of the Ma family note that this Western education was a cornerstone of Jack Ma’s vision for his son. "I told my son: you don't need to be in the top three in your class, being in the middle is fine, so long as your grades aren't too bad. Only this kind of person has enough free time to learn other skills," Jack Ma famously stated during a public forum. This philosophy highlights a preference for well-rounded development over the high-pressure academic competition common in the Chinese "Gaokao" system.

Career Trajectory and Professional Discretion

Following his graduation from UC Berkeley, the career path of Ma Yuankun has remained a subject of intense speculation. Unlike other high-profile heirs like Wang Sicong (son of Dalian Wanda Group’s Wang Jianlin), who frequently makes headlines for his business ventures and social media presence, Yuankun has opted for a path of professional discretion. He has not taken a high-profile executive role within Alibaba Group, a move that aligns with Jack Ma’s public stance on professional management versus family succession.

There are several reasons why Ma Yuankun may have chosen to stay out of the corporate limelight:

  • Professional Management: Jack Ma has long advocated for Alibaba to be run by professional managers rather than a family dynasty. By not installing his son in a senior role, he reinforces the company’s commitment to meritocracy.
  • Personal Interests: Reports suggest that Yuankun has interests in the tech and investment sectors that may lie outside the direct ecosystem of Alibaba. This allows him to build his own reputation.
  • Safety and Privacy: In the current regulatory and social climate in China, maintaining a low profile is often a strategic choice for the offspring of high-net-worth individuals.

The Philosophy of the Ma Household

To understand Ma Yuankun, one must understand the values Jack Ma has projected regarding wealth and legacy. Jack Ma has frequently stated that he views his wealth as a responsibility rather than a personal possession. This sentiment is reflected in how he has raised his son. In a 2015 interview, Jack Ma remarked, "When you have one million dollars, that’s your money. When you have twenty million dollars, you start to have problems... When you have one billion dollars, that’s not your money, that’s the trust society gives to you."
